Why Petroleum Jelly Captures So Much Attention: Wrinkles, Hydration, and Honest Expectations
Wrinkles do not appear overnight, and they rarely arise from a single cause. Time, sun exposure, repetitive facial movement, genetics, and lifestyle choices all push skin toward lines and folds. When dryness adds to the picture, fine lines look sharper and skin feels tight. That is where petroleum jelly enters the conversation. This simple, inert occlusive has a reputation for locking in hydration and creating a comforting seal, making parched skin appear smoother. The appeal is clear: it is accessible, straightforward to use, and gentle for many. But accessibility is not the same as transformation, and setting the right expectations matters.
To understand what petroleum jelly can reasonably achieve, it helps to distinguish types of lines. Dynamic lines come from muscle movement and are visible with expressions; static lines are etched even at rest; dehydration lines are shallow and fluctuate with moisture levels. Petroleum jelly’s strength sits squarely in the dehydration category. By sealing in water, it can temporarily soften the look of fine lines and help the skin barrier feel more resilient. However, wrinkles related to collagen and elastin loss require strategies that influence deeper skin biology.
Think of petroleum jelly like a winter coat for your skin. It keeps what you already have—your skin’s own water—close to the surface, where it can plump up cells and minimize tightness. Yet a coat cannot rebuild beams in a house. Similarly, an occlusive cannot replace lost collagen or reorganize elastic fibers. That is why many people find it most useful as a supportive player rather than a standalone fix. Used thoughtfully, it can enhance comfort, boost the effect of your moisturizer, and reduce the visibility of dryness-related lines, especially overnight in dry climates.
Key takeaways at this stage:
– It improves hydration by sealing in water but does not stimulate new collagen.
– It most noticeably softens dehydration lines, not deeply etched wrinkles.
– It can be part of an effective routine but is rarely the centerpiece for wrinkle correction.
The Science of Occlusion: How Petroleum Jelly Reduces TEWL and Supports the Barrier
Skin constantly loses water to the environment, a process called transepidermal water loss (TEWL). In cooler months, low humidity accelerates TEWL, leaving skin dehydrated and vulnerable. Petroleum jelly forms a semi-occlusive film—think of a breathable tarp over a garden bed. In dermatology literature, petrolatum has been shown to reduce TEWL dramatically, with measurements often cited around the 90–98% range compared with untreated skin. This effect is not magic; it is simple physics. By creating a hydrophobic barrier, petroleum jelly slows evaporation, letting the stratum corneum hold more water and function more effectively.
The material itself is a blend of purified hydrocarbons. It is chemically inert, fragrance-free by default, and widely used as a base in wound care because it protects without interacting much with skin chemistry. Interestingly, petroleum jelly is considered non-comedogenic in standard rating systems, meaning it does not inherently clog pores. Still, its occlusive nature can trap other products beneath it, amplifying irritation from potent actives or locking in comedogenic ingredients if those are present.
What happens under that thin film? Water content rises in the outer layers, corneocyte flexibility improves, and micro-fissures from dryness become less prominent. The skin’s barrier enzymes work better in a hydrated environment, which can indirectly aid recovery from mild irritation. When layered correctly—typically over a water-based serum or moisturizer—it can extend the life of those hydrating layers through the night. Compared with other occlusives, its performance is notable:
– Petrolatum: very high TEWL reduction, excellent seal
– Waxes and butters: moderate seal with creamier texture
– Silicones (e.g., dimethicone): moderate occlusion with lighter feel
Caveats matter. Under strong exfoliating acids or retinoids, occlusion can intensify penetration and irritation in sensitive users. In very hot, sweaty conditions, a heavy seal may feel smothering. Around the eyes, a whisper-thin layer is usually enough to avoid milia risk. Patch testing a small area for several nights helps catch issues early. Used thoughtfully, the science behind petroleum jelly is simple, predictable, and reliable: it holds onto moisture and protects the barrier.
What It Can and Can’t Do for Wrinkles: Evidence, Limits, and Realistic Outcomes
The question most people ask is straightforward: will petroleum jelly reduce wrinkles? The honest answer is nuanced. It can visibly soften dehydration lines and improve surface smoothness by keeping water in the outer skin layers. It can make makeup sit better and help thin, crepey areas look less crinkled after a night’s rest. These changes are real, but they are largely optical and comfort-related. They come from increased hydration and barrier support, not from structural remodeling of the dermis where long-term wrinkles originate.
For deeper, static lines and texture caused by sun damage, ingredients with a track record in controlled trials are more appropriate. Topical retinoids have been shown to improve fine wrinkling and uneven tone with consistent use over months. Daily sunscreen helps prevent new photoaging changes that eventually manifest as wrinkles and spots. Gentle chemical exfoliants and peptides may contribute modest benefits in texture and tone for some users. Compared with these, petroleum jelly functions as a supportive layer rather than a driver of change.
It helps to sort claims into “can” and “can’t”:
– Can: reduce TEWL and boost hydration, soften the appearance of fine dehydration lines, enhance comfort of dry or irritated skin, support barrier recovery, improve moisturization efficiency overnight.
– Can’t: erase etched wrinkles, replicate the effects of retinoids or in-office procedures, lift sagging skin, replace daily sun protection, or permanently change skin structure.
There is also timing to consider. The smoothing effect tends to be most noticeable short-term—overnight or within a few days—when dryness is the dominant issue. Over weeks, the benefit remains primarily about comfort and maintenance. For individuals with very dry or compromised skin, that steady support can reduce flare-ups and help other actives be better tolerated. For oilier or acne-prone skin, a lighter approach or targeted use on drier zones may be more appropriate. If wrinkles are the main concern, petroleum jelly is a reliable assistant, but the lead roles belong to sun protection, proven actives, and, when desired, professional treatments.
How to Use Petroleum Jelly Strategically and Safely for Smoother-Looking Skin
Application matters as much as the product. Think “thin and strategic,” not “thick and everywhere” unless your skin is extremely dry or irritated. Start by cleansing with a gentle, non-stripping cleanser. While the skin is slightly damp, apply a humectant-rich serum or a lightweight moisturizer. Wait a minute for it to settle. Then, warm a pea- to lima-bean-sized amount of petroleum jelly between your fingertips and press a sheer film onto targeted areas—under-eye periphery, cheekbones, or any flaky zones. Many people reserve full-face application for dry seasons or travel days with low humidity.
Practical pointers for different needs:
– Dry, sensitive skin: use a thin layer nightly over a simple moisturizer to reduce TEWL.
– Combination skin: spot-apply on dry patches or edges of the eyes and mouth.
– Oily or acne-prone skin: consider applying only on the driest zones; avoid active breakouts.
– Using actives: be cautious layering over strong retinoids or acids, as occlusion can intensify irritation.
– Eye area: keep the layer very thin to reduce the chance of milia.
If slugging interests you (using an occlusive as the final step at night), begin two to three nights per week. Evaluate in the morning: does skin feel calm and springy, or congested and greasy? Adjust frequency accordingly. In humid climates, you may prefer a lighter occlusive or just a richer cream. In arid environments or during winter, a slightly more generous layer can make a notable difference in morning comfort and makeup application.
Safety notes are straightforward. Patch test first, especially if you use exfoliants or retinoids. Avoid trapping potentially irritating formulas beneath an occlusive; separate them on different nights if needed. Cleanse gently in the morning to remove residue. If you notice new closed comedones or milia, pause, scale back quantity, or reserve use for the driest areas only. Thoughtful technique turns a simple jar into a reliable moisture lock without unwanted side effects.
Alternatives, Pairings, and Cost–Benefit: Building a Smarter Routine
Petroleum jelly shines as a moisture seal, but it is just one tool. Understanding how it complements other categories helps you build a balanced routine. Skincare products typically fall into three helpful groups: humectants draw water into the skin, emollients smooth and soften by filling tiny gaps, and occlusives slow water from escaping. A routine that stacks these intelligently can look and feel more effective than any single product alone, especially for wrinkle-prone, dry, or mature skin.
Consider these strategic pairings:
– Humectant + emollient + petroleum jelly: for very dry skin, this trio can boost plumpness and comfort overnight.
– Humectant + silicone-based occlusive: for oilier types, a lighter-feeling occlusive may be preferable to a waxy seal.
– Ceramide-rich cream alone: for those who dislike occlusives, a well-formulated moisturizer can support the barrier without an extra layer.
– Shea or plant butters: provide emollience and mild occlusion with a richer, balmier texture; patch test if sensitive.
Cost–benefit often favors petroleum jelly because a small amount covers a large area, and the formula is simple. But simplicity raises other questions: texture preference, finish, and compatibility with actives. Some users prefer the weightless feel of dimethicone-based occlusives or oils like squalane that absorb more completely. Others appreciate the unmistakable seal of petrolatum on chapped areas or after wind exposure. Sustainability may also influence your choice; plant-derived emollients or silicone-based barriers are alternatives if you prefer to avoid petroleum-derived ingredients.
When wrinkles remain a top concern despite diligent moisturizing, consider options with stronger evidence for structural change. Daily broad-spectrum sunscreen limits further photoaging. Retinoids can refine fine lines over months. Gentle, regular exfoliation can brighten and smooth. Professional pathways—such as neuromodulator injections for dynamic lines, soft-tissue fillers for volume loss, and various lasers or peels for texture—address specific mechanisms of aging. A practical roadmap:
– Keep petroleum jelly for hydration support and comfort.
– Use sunscreen every morning to prevent new damage.
– Introduce one proven active at a time and give it months, not days.
– Seek professional guidance for targeted, procedural options when desired.
In short, petroleum jelly is an outstanding moisture lock in a world of complex promises. It will not rewrite the biology of aging, but it can make your routine work harder and your skin feel calmer. Combine it with smart sun habits and well-chosen actives, and you have a routine that respects both science and common sense.
